Slumdog millionaire

A Mumbai teen is on an Indian version of "who wants to be a millionaire" He knows every answer and is arrested on suspicion of cheating. During his interrogation the reasons for his knowing every answer is revealed.

Directedby Danny Boyle

Stars: Dev Patel, Freida Pinto.

Release date was 9th Janaury 2009

Runtime: 120 minutes

Budget: £15,000,000
Gross: £141, 319,195 (USA)
           £31,283,374    (UK)

Film four

Film four was established in 1998

Film four has a budget of £15,000,000 a year

Film four is controlled by Tessa Ross

New releases from Film four include: End of the year, let me in and Slumdog Millionaire.

Film four tend to focus on films on Social Realism.

Film four has recently created Film Four OD. Channel Four partnered with Filmflex to create the new online viewing service.

As it is a British production company it finances British films.

Part of Channel Fours remit was to experiment and innovate and cater for audiences not addressed by other channels (niche audiences)

Film Four fund around 20 films per year.

They look for distinctive films which will make there mark in a competive cinema market.

Films are premiered two years after theatrical releases, they are only premiered on Film Four, Channel four or a sister company.

David Rose, commissioning editor "a preference for contemporary and social political topics"
Examples including My Beautiful Laundrette, Which portrayed a homosexual relationship between a white facist and Omar.

Film Four is in association with the Uk's museum of moving image (MOMI) and often has various film related weeks and weekends. E.g Horror week or sci fi weekend.

Film Four has a subsidary group named the Film Four lab which supports the "newest amd most striking creative voices and visions of tommorrow's cinema in Britain"
